As an Analyst - Fresher Full Underwriter in our Operations team, you will be responsible for evaluating applications and data to ensure compliance with standards and guidelines. Your role will be crucial in contributing to the efficiency and success of our operations. This position offers a great opportunity for you to kickstart your career in underwriting and grow in a dynamic environment.

Key Responsibilities:
- Review and assess applications for compliance with established standards.
- Perform underwriting analysis to determine risk and eligibility.
- Collaborate with senior team members to support decision-making and process improvements.
- Prepare and maintain accurate documentation for underwriting processes.
- Communicate effectively with internal and external stakeholders for information clarification.
- Adhere to operational procedures and regulatory requirements.
- Identify opportunities for streamlining processes to enhance efficiency.

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Finance, or a related field.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English.
- Keen attention to detail and ability to make objective decisions.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, including Excel and Word.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Highly motivated with a willingness to learn and grow within the organization.
